China unveils world’s first hybrid rig to drill and blast through mountains
The new boring-and-blasting tunnel machine boosts hard-rock digging efficiency by 30% — a leap for high-end underground engineering.
🔸 Co-developed by Tsinghua University and a unit of China Railway Group, the 4.5m-diameter "Xianglong" rolled off the line in Wuhan
🔸 Standard tunnel boring machines slow down in extremely hard or fractured mountain rock — the hybrid rig integrates excavation with built-in drilling and blasting to solve this
🔸 Built entirely with a domestic supply chain, it will undergo its first on-site trial at a pumped-storage power plant in Henan
This innovation offers a homegrown solution for massive construction as China pushes deep-tunnel infrastructure under its 15th five-year plan.
